Rafael Nadal wins
against Mardy Fish at Wimbledon
The French Open champion
Rafael Nadal justified the odds and won against Fish to move to
round two of the 2007 Wimbledon.
Rafael
Nadal won his first round at the 2007 Wimbledon 6-3 7-6 (7-4)
6-3 against the American Mardy Fish. Although the strong side of
the Spaniard is clay, Fish gave the French Open winner only
minor troubles. Rafael Nadal, who won a third consecutive Roland
Garros title earlier this month, is looking to follow Bjorn Borg
to win French Open and Wimbledon titles in the same year.
In the second round of the Wimbledon
Rafael Nadal will face Austria's Werner Eschauer.
